Meet Unique Note: Interview With Tetsuya Shibata and Yoshino Aoki

Two prominent members from the audio team at Capcom Japan recently left to start their own music production company called Unique Note. Tetsuya Shibata was formerly the Sound Director at Capcom Japan where he oversaw a number of projects including Resident Evil 5 and the Devil May Cry series, and Yoshino Aoki was a composer who worked on the Megaman EXE and Breath of Fire series. OSV gets the first word in with the duo about what they hope to accomplish and the philosophy of Unique Note.
